If the seller’s tax ID number is not provided on Form 593-C, what does the escrow officer do?

0

If the seller does not have or does not provide a tax ID number on Forms 593, 593-C, or 593-E then: • The seller does not qualify for an exemption. • Any certification of an exemption is void, and the escrow officer should withhold 3 1/3 percent of the total sales price.
